Overview
Come and join Carey Reid, SABES Staff Developer for Licensure and Curriculum & Assessment for an overview of the newly established Massachusetts ABE Teacher's License.
Details
Carey’s presentation will cover the basic requirements of the license including the various routes to licensure and available support materials. Support services provided by SABES will also be discussed. The session will culminate with a walk through of building an ABE teacher license portfolio.
